This repository has been archived on 2024-09-30. You can view files and clone it. You cannot open issues or pull requests or push a commit.
Files
SmartRollCall/app/templates/announcement.html
2023-12-30 22:44:36 +08:00

130 lines
4.4 KiB
HTML
Raw Permalink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8"/>
<title>公告信息</title>
<meta name="renderer" content="webkit"/>
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1"/>
<meta name="viewport" content="width=device-width, initial-scale=1"/>
<link href="static/css/layui.css" rel="stylesheet"/>
<style>
/* 容器样式 */
.layui-container {
padding: 20px;
background-color: #f7f7f7;
border-radius: 8px;
box-shadow: 0 2px 10px rgba(0, 0, 0, 0.1);
margin-bottom: 20px;
}
/* 标题样式 */
.layui-header {
margin-bottom: 20px;
font-size: 2em; /* 更大的标题字体 */
color: #333;
border-bottom: 2px solid #e2e2e2;
padding-bottom: 10px;
}
/* 课程信息样式 */
.layui-field-box p {
font-size: 1.2em; /* 更大的文字 */
margin: 10px 0; /* 调整段落间距 */
padding: 10px; /* 内边距 */
background-color: #fff; /* 背景色 */
border-radius: 4px; /* 轻微的圆角 */
box-shadow: 0 2px 4px rgba(0, 0, 0, 0.05); /* 细微的阴影 */
}
/* 字段集合样式调整 */
fieldset.layui-elem-field {
border-color: #ddd; /* 更淡的边框颜色 */
}
legend {
font-size: 1.4em; /* Legend文字大小 */
color: #333; /* 文字颜色 */
}
</style>
</head>
<body>
<div class="layui-layout layui-layout-admin">
<div class="layui-header">
<div class="layui-logo layui-hide-xs layui-bg-black">网上上课点名系统</div>
<!-- 头部区域可配合layui 已有的水平导航) -->
<ul class="layui-nav layui-layout-right">
<li class="layui-nav-item layui-hide layui-show-sm-inline-block">
<a href="javascript:;">
<img
src="//unpkg.com/outeres@0.0.10/img/layui/icon-v2.png"
class="layui-nav-img"
/>
{{ session.name }}
</a>
<dl class="layui-nav-child">
<dd><a href="/home/profile">资料</a></dd> <!-- 修改这里的href指向/profile -->
<dd><a href="javascript:;" id="logoutLink">登出</a></dd>
</dl>
</li>
<li
class="layui-nav-item"
lay-header-event="menuRight"
lay-unselect
></li>
</ul>
</div>
<div class="layui-side layui-bg-black">
<div class="layui-side-scroll">
<!-- 动态加载菜单栏 -->
<ul class="layui-nav layui-nav-tree" lay-filter="test">
</ul>
</div>
</div>
<div class="layui-body">
<div class="layui-container">
<div class="layui-row">
<div class="layui-col-xs12">
<h1 class="layui-header">公告</h1>
</div>
</div>
<div class="layui-row">
<div class="layui-col-md6">
<fieldset class="layui-elem-field">
<legend>今日课程</legend>
<div class="layui-field-box" id="courses-container">
<!-- 课程信息将通过JavaScript动态添加 -->
</div>
</fieldset>
</div>
</div>
</div>
</div>
</div>
<script src="static/jquery.min.js"></script> <!-- 确保已经引入jQuery -->
<script src="static/layui.js"></script>
<script src="/static/js/menu.js"></script>
<script src="/static/js/logout.js"></script>
<script>
$(document).ready(function () {
// 请求后端获取课程信息
$.get('/api/get-today-courses', function (data) {
if (data.msg == "ok") {
data.data.forEach(function (course) {
// 为每个课程创建一个段落<p>并添加到容器中,并设置样式使字体更大且更加好看
$('#courses-container').append('<p style="font-size: 1.2em; margin: 5px 0;">课程: ' + course.course_name + ' <br> 时间: ' + course.time + '</p>');
});
} else {
$('#courses-container').append(data.msg)
}
});
});
</script>
</body>
</html>